  1. James White is a 2015 American drama film written and directed by Josh Mond. The film stars Christopher Abbott, Cynthia Nixon, Scott Mescudi, Ron Livingston, Makenzie Leigh and David Call. James, a twenty-something New Yorker, struggles to take control of his self-destructive behavior in the face of momentous family challenges.

  6. A young man (Christopher Abbott) struggles with grief, addiction and responsibility after his father's death and his mother's cancer in this realistic and powerful film by Josh Mond. The film features close-up cinematography, a revelatory performance by Cynthia Nixon, and a moving scene of James telling his mother a dream.
